High Court Questions Bank Auction After 39-Acre Kodagu Coffee Plantation Worth ₹3.12 Crore Sold for ₹99 Lakh
Representative image of coffee estate Bengaluru: The Karnataka High Court has raised serious questions over the valuation and auction of a 39-acre coffee and cardamom plantation in Kodagu district after finding that the property, which was valued at more than ₹3.12 crore when a loan was sanctioned in 2014, was assessed at just ₹61 lakh in 2024 before being sold in a bank auction for only ₹99 lakh.
